Fitzwilliam, NH (New Hampshire) Houses and Residents

Estimated median house or condo value in 2022: $257,005 (it was $99,200 in 2000)

Lower value quartile - upper value quartile: $200,496 - $334,730

Total population: 2,396 (Urban population: 0, Rural population: 2,141 (4 farm, 2,137 nonfarm))

Houses: 1,074 (836 occupied: 695 owner occupied, 141 renter occupied)

Housing density: 31 houses/condos per square mile

Median price asked for vacant for-sale houses and condos in 2022 in this county: $225,021.

Median contract rent in 2022: $963 (lower quartile is $666, upper quartile is $1,390)


Median gross rent in Fitzwilliam, NH in 2022: $1,167

Housing units in Fitzwilliam with a mortgage: 342 (32 second mortgage, 39 home equity loan, 3 both second mortgage and home equity loan)
Houses without a mortgage: 124

97.0% of residents of Fitzwilliam speak English at home.
0.8% of residents speak Spanish at home (76% speak English very well, 24% speak English well).
1.3% of residents speak other Indo-European language at home (92% speak English very well, 8% speak English well).
0.4% of residents speak Asian or Pacific Island language at home (100% speak English very well).
0.4% of residents speak other language at home (100% speak English very well).

Foreign born population: 63 (2.8%)
(49.2% of them are naturalized citizens)

Housing units in structures:

  • One, detached: 865
  • One, attached: 12
  • Two: 48
  • 3 or 4: 14
  • 5 to 9: 15
  • Mobile homes: 116
  • Boats, RVs, vans, etc.: 4

Median worth of mobile homes: $56,766

Housing units lacking complete plumbing facilities: 1.8%

Housing units lacking complete kitchen facilities: 1.5%
